About Rehoming

When people create threads looking to rehome their pigs there are a few guidelines that should be followed. All too often these days I see people needing to rehome their pigs for whatever reason.

These members should:
1) Be highly encouraged to find home for the pigs themselves.
2) Be given resources to sites or forums where they can create listings to find a good responsible home for their pigs. Places would include: Guinea Lynx :: A Medical and Care Guide for Guinea Pigs, Index of /, Petfinder.com: Adopt a pet and help an animal shelter rescue a puppy or kitten., Guinea Pig Rescue and Health Forum - Pigloo.net, and others.
3) They should NOT be berated, condemned, griped at, yelled at or be condescended for whatever reason they have for wanting or needing to rehome their pigs. This really needs to stop. I have seen this happen too much lately. The reason really doesn't matter as much as the person finding a new good home for their pig(s). I know we all may not agree with the reason but griping at the person about their reason isn't going to help find the pig(s) a new home.
4) They should not be encouraged to give their pigs to the already overcrowded shelters or given links to shelters/rescues near them unless it's an absolute last resort and they are going to just dump the pigs somewhere. A shelter/rescue is definately better than just letting pigs loose somewhere or dumping them.

If you all will follow these guidelines, I'm sure we can do much better at helping members find new homes for their pigs.
